Rising in Guyana's highlands,the Berbice River flows northward 370 mi (595 km) through dense forests to the Atlantic Ocean. Its basin is restricted by the proximity of the larger Essequibo and Corentyne rivers.The name is derived from a Dutch colony that became part of British Guiana (now Guyana) in 1831.
